Professional Certificate in Ice Storm Monitoring
Gain essential skills in ice storm monitoring with our comprehensive online training program. Designed for meteorologists, environmental scientists, and emergency response professionals, this course covers weather patterns, data analysis techniques, and forecasting strategies specific to ice storms. Learn how to interpret radar images, predict ice accumulation, and mitigate potential hazards.
